SUMMARY

Under the supervision of the Health Center Manager (HCM) and Clinic Services Supervisor (CSS), the Medical Assistant (MA) plays a key role in delivering efficient, high-quality care to patients at Community Health Centers of the Central Coast (CHCCC). Depending on the site and specialty, the MA performs non-professional clinical duties, operates medical and laboratory equipment, and assists with patient care, including physically demanding tasks.

Additionally, the MA supports the team with clerical duties and helping maintain effective workflow and operations.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Actively participates in assigned Patient Care Team duties and activities.

Administers medications via oral, parenteral routes, and topical routes as per Provider’s written orders. If MA is unfamiliar with medication, he/she refers to nursing drug handbook prior to administering and consults with Provider and/or RN on site.

Performs preliminary intake of vitals and determines need for immunizations, lead screening, preventative exams, and other health maintenance recommendations for specific age groups.

Performs in-house CLIA Waived laboratory tests (urinalysis, pregnancy tests, strep, etc.) Observes manufacturer instructions and ensures quality controls have been performed each day.

May assist with referral and tracking for routine visits, ancillary services, and external providers, notes tracking in medical record and in the appropriate software program as indicated by CHCCC.

Greets patients using two patient identifiers, escorts them to examination room, assists in monitoring patient waiting areas, including patient examination rooms in the event of an acute situation, and to minimize the patient’s waiting and maximize the utilization of the provider and the clinic.

Acts to minimize the emotional discomfort associated with an office visit. Provides comfort and encouragement for patients with anxiety.

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E

High school diploma or GED required. Graduation from an accredited school in Medical Assisting or certification/registration (CMA/RMA) through a California Medical Board-approved medical assistant certifying organization. If MA does not have a CMA or RMA at time of hire, employee must be able to pass test within one year of employment. Minimum one year of recent medical assisting work experience ಕಡೆ medical field preferred.

Electrocardiogram (EKG), vital signs, venipuncture, injections experience preferred.
